14:22 — Canary gating rules on the Brindlewick plugin pipeline blocked promotion for all third-party bundles, not just the flagged one. Root cause: the gate matched on channel, not plugin ID. Plugin authors saw stalled deploys for ~40 minutes. Fix shipped in gatekeeper v3.1; scoping now per-plugin. If your deploy was stuck during this window, re-trigger it; no data was lost. The affected gate evaluation is identified by the trace token below.

session token of tajef-bageg = htk21_5d90d574934f3ccae6437

## Configuration

Tracing in the Ostermill stack uses the Lanternway collector. Every service propagates the trace header; gaps usually mean a service restarted with tracing disabled. Support can confirm by checking the collector dashboard for missing spans. Sampling defaults to 10%; set TRACE_SAMPLE_RATE=1.0 only while reproducing an issue, then revert. The collector rejects unauthenticated span pushes, so each service's .env must include the ingest credential on the following line:

sealed setting: VAULT_KEY3=eec

The incident occurred because conflicting event edits from the Pinefold connector were auto-merged without verifying the editor's authorization scope, letting a stale token overwrite newer entries. Remediation: enforce scope checks before merge, log all conflict resolutions with actor identity, and alert on merges involving expired credentials. Owner: sync platform team, due end of quarter. The revised conflict-handling design and audit logging spec are on the internal page below.

wiki page, tahaf-tajog: https://jira.ordindyn.corp/pipeline